Banks line up to offer students wide range of incentives to open accounts

FREE flights, €100 cash and discount travel cards are among the incentives being used by banks to encourage students to open accounts.

All of the main banks are offering students fee-free banking as well as a range of incentives.

Ulster Bank is offering €100 cash which will be paid out in two €50 installments in January and February. Bank of Ireland is offering a free return flight to a choice of 10 European cities.
